Today I made this incredible dish VINEGAR CHICKEN WITH CRUSHED OLIVE DRESSING for my client.  It is not my personal recipe and was gifted to me.  I consider everything that is given to me from the heart a gift.  I am definitely adding it to my repertoire.  It is so delicious and easy to make.  I went crazy when I tasted it.  This dish can easily fit into a KETO lifestyle and all ingredients are Kosher friendly when using Kosher Vinegar.  Make sure that you buy Chicken parts that have the skin on so the result can be a crispy, golden brown, mouthwatering delight.  It's perfect for a family style dinner or a buffet.  I hope you enjoy it as much as I do and as much as my client did.  Here's to your health.  By the way, the sauce, when poured over the chicken pieces, is loaded with garlic, a great blood cleanser.  Enjoy folks.   
               VINEGAR CHICKEN
​    WITH CRUSHED OLIVE DRESSING

Yields 4 servings
3 1/2 lbs. bone in, skin on Chicken Parts (use your favorite parts of the Chicken)
1 teaspoon ground Turmeric
6 Tablespoons Extra Virgin Olive Oil
Kosher Salt and Pepper
1/2 cup White Wine Vinegar
1 1/2 cups Green Castelvetrano Olives (I bought at Whole Foods Market)
crushed and pitted
3 cloves Garlic, finely minced
1 cup Parsley chopped

1)  Heat the oven to 450 degrees.  Pour 2 Tablespoons of the Extra Virgin Olive Oil and Turmeric in a large bowl and mix thoroughly.  Dredge the chicken parts in the mixture covering all parts of the Chicken.  You may have to add more Olive Oil.  Set the Chicken in a baking dish making sure the Chicken is skin side up.  Season the chicken with Salt and Pepper. 
2)  Pour the White Wine Vinegar over and around the chicken and place the baking dish in the oven.  Bake the Chicken without flipping it until cooked through and deeply golden brown all over, 25-30 minutes.
3)  Meanwhile combine the crushed and pitted Olives, minced Garlic, chopped Parsley, the remaining 4 Tablespoons Extra Virgin Olive Oil and 2 Tablespoons of Water in a small bowl.  Season with Salt and Pepper.   
4)  After the Chicken has browned on one side flip the pieces over.  Gently scrape the bottom of the baking pan to loosen all the brown bits and then pour the contents of the small bowl over the Chicken, moving the topping and the Chicken around to mix with the brown bits.  
5)  Bake another 15 minutes until the Chicken browns on the other side.  Serve.  Don't forget to spoon the Garlic, Parsley and Olives over the Chicken when serving.  Yummmmm!!!!!
